Features
An impoundment of the Republican River, Milford Lake has become one of the best fishing lakes in Kansas. Along with being the largest man-made lake in Kansas, Milford Lake offers great opportunities for walleye, wiper, bass, and giant blue catfish. This 15,709 acres reservoir sits upon a bed of limestone and clay and cuts through part of the Flint Hills. Limestone bluffs and rocky points as well as stretches of sandy beaches make up the picturesque shorelines.
Although originally impounded for flood control and water quality, but with the help of the Kansas Dept. of Wildlife, Parks and Tourism, Milford Lake soon became a top fishery in Kansas. Anglers can enjoy numerous opportunities for 80 plus pound blue catfish, big walleyes, trophy smallmouth bass and hard fighting wipers and white bass. You’re almost guaranteed to catch fish in these beautiful waters.
Forage
Early in the year many fish will feed on invertebrates and aquatic insects. Gizzard shad, shiners, bluegills and large crustaceans are abundant and provide forage for bigger fish.
Seasonal Movements
During early April, walleyes will concentrate along the face of the dam or along some of the shallow gravel shorelines to spawn. Following spawn walleyes will move throughout the lake and move to deeper water during the summer months. White bass will make a run up the Republican River usually late April, early May. In summer, white bass can be found chasing schools of shad throughout the lake. Crappies relate to the wooded coves during the spring to spawn. By summer they can be found suspended in deeper water not far from their spawning grounds. Then by fall crappies will relate to spring time areas and will school up in big groups.
